Meningoencephalitis is a medical condition that simultaneously resembles both meningitis, which is an infection or inflammation of the meninges, and encephalitis, which is an infection or inflammation of the brain. Causative organisms include both viral and bacterial pathogens. Other causes include antibodies targetting amyloid beta peptide proteins which have been used during research on Alzheimer's disease.
